- Day 3
Dürnstein - Melk
This morning starts in Dürnstein, where you can walk through medieval architecture and see terraced vineyards covering the hillsides. The ruins of Dürnstein Castle sit above the town, offering views of the Danube below. After exploring there, you'll cruise downstream to Melk, where a massive Benedictine monastery dominates the hilltop. This monastery is a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and from the river it's quite the sight as you approach the town.

Landmarks Dürnstein Castle Melk Abbey Wachau Valley - Day 4
Linz
You'll dock in Linz at 07:00 with the whole day to explore. The city blends cultural attractions with modern creativity, and you should definitely try the Linzer Torte, a famous local pastry, at a local cafe. The ship doesn't leave until 19:30, so there's plenty of time to see Linz's design and art scene before returning to the ship.
